Both CPUs are the same socket type so should be okay if BIOS supports Q6600, if it doesn't then hopefully your PC maker has released a BIOS update to make it compatible - - - best if you check the Acer website first or just risk it and buy a Q6600 to see if it works. Sorry can't be more certain but it's not easy to find CPU upgrade info for factory-built computers, you might want to contact Acer tech support and ask them.
